Greenhouse structure is one of the most important factors in the greenhouse industry; increasing energy prices is a major challenge for greenhouse owners. Greenhouses should be so designed that they have high light transmission especially in winter and at the same time satisfy the requirements of the construction cost and the safety against the loads which may be imposed upon them. In this research, the goal is to optimize the shape and direction of the greenhouse to minimize the energy required for heating. The design parameters in this work are determined for two different types of greenhouses with the target functions, with the gray wolf optimization method. An approach to developing variable-rate sprayer technologies is to install electronic control systems on conventional sprayers. This study introduces a direct injection type electronic solution concentration control system. This control system was installed on a field sprayer, and then a map-based variable-rate sprayer was developed. The control system consisted of a chemical tank, a chemical metering pump, the metering pump’s driver, the metering pump’s speed sensor, the implement’s travelling speed sensor, an Electronic Control Unit (ECU), a GPS receiver and a mixing unit.
